@Gillford101 Yeah, that's pretty much right. The naginata was a very common battle field weapon in the early sengoku jidai (if not earlier), but was eventually overtaken in popularity by the yari(spear). This was mostly due to the large swinging motions, required for effective cutting, had a tendency for 'friendly fire', when you had many samurai in tight formations.
It was later made popular by women for more or less the reasons above, longer range, more power with less strength, etc.
@TheGAMEBOY1994 What I believe you're referring to is the sport Atarashii naginata, which did have some of it's origins in women's use of the weapon, and is now mostly dominated by female practitioners. That said, it's far from 'the girl version of kendo', it's more like another branch of the sport, if anything :)
